Is Trader Joe's Quartered Marinated Artichokes Vegan?

Description
Quartered marinated artichoke pieces offer a mild tang and savory depth with a tender yet slightly firm, meaty texture; commonly added to salads, antipasto platters, pasta, pizzas, sandwiches, and dips. Customer reviews highlight convenient preparation, consistent flavor, occasional variability in marination intensity or brininess, and perceived value by shoppers.

Ingredients
Artichoke, Water, Sunflower Oil, Cane Vinegar, Sea Salt, Spices, Garlic Powder, Ascorbic Acid (To Preserve), Citric Acid (Acidifier).
What is a Vegan diet?
A vegan diet excludes all animal-derived foods, including meat, poultry, fish, dairy, eggs, and honey. It focuses on plant-based sources such as fruits, vegetables, grains, legumes, nuts, and seeds. Many people choose veganism for ethical, environmental, or health reasons. When well-planned, it provides sufficient protein, fiber, and antioxidants, though supplementation or fortified foods may be needed for nutrients like vitamin B12, iron, and omega-3 fatty acids. Vegan diets are associated with lower risks of heart disease and improved digestion but require mindfulness to ensure balanced and complete nutrition.
